Troubleshooting Common Issues With Central Vacuums

With central vacuums, a quick fix usually makes all the difference.

The problems we see most are lost suction, motor failures, and clogged pipes. If yours won't turn on, check the power unit and make sure every connection is secure.

For suction trouble, look at the hoses and filters for blockages. And if you smell burning, it often means worn attachments that need replacing.

Top Benefits of Central Vacuum Systems for Your Home

Keeping a central vacuum maintained keeps it performing, and there's a lot to like about owning one. What homeowners tend to appreciate:

  • Powerful cleaning. Central vacuums out-clean traditional models, so you get a deeper clean.
  • Improved air quality. The filtration system exhausts dust outside, which helps your indoor air.
  • Quiet operation. With the unit installed away from living areas, cleaning is a lot quieter.
  • Convenient use. Lightweight hoses make moving around the house easy.

Essential Maintenance Tips for Your Central Vacuum System

A bit of regular maintenance keeps a central vacuum running well and lasting longer. A few things to stay on top of:

  • Check and replace filters regularly to keep the suction strong.
  • Inspect hoses and attachments for clogs or wear, and replace them when needed.
  • Clean out the vacuum canister often to prevent buildup and odors.
  • Book a professional tune-up at least once a year.

Frequently asked questions

How long does a central vacuum installation typically take? Usually four to eight hours, depending on the size and layout of the home. We keep it smooth so you can start using the system almost right away.

Are central vacuum systems suitable for small homes? Yes. They're powerful, efficient, and space-saving. They help with air quality and make cleaning easier - size isn't a limit.

What brands do you offer for central vacuum systems? We carry a few, including Beam, Nutone, and Vacuflo. Each has its own strengths, so there's a fit for most cleaning needs.

Can I install a central vacuum myself? We wouldn't recommend it unless you've got the experience. It involves precise measurements and connections, so it's usually best left to professionals for proper install and performance.

What warranties are available for central vacuum products? Most come with warranties covering defects and specific parts. Check with the manufacturer for the details, since coverage varies.
